KEN Livingstone, the consummate political hack, has learned that just mentioning carbon emissions is enough to stifle criticism these days. What better way to create the mandate for any old restrictive policy and rubbish your opponents? The need for decent transport (rather than restrictions on transport), personal freedom (rather than increased monitoring) and more infrastructure (rather than repackaging existing infrastructure) is as important today as ever, but accepting an environmentalist agenda lets these fundamental issues go unchallenged.

Even your leader column has been suckered into claiming Ken "deserves credit" for his bid to make next month's contest a "green election".
